Research Shows How AHCC(R) May Help Fight Flu and Other Infectious Agents



October 7th, 2008

A new paper published in Nutrition Reviews (Vol. 66(9):526-531) by Dr. Barry W. Ritz, PhD, Department of Bioscience and Biotechnology at Drexel University, has shown how AHCC impacts the immune response against a number of infectious agents.

The scientific review analyzed outcomes from in vivo studies evaluating the effect of AHCC supplementation on immune response following challenge with a variety of infectious agents such as the influenza (flu) virus, avian influenza (bird flu), Methicillin-Res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A), Klebsiella pnuemoniae and Candida albicans.
